The Psychology of Lying and Methods of Lie Detection

The Psychology of Lying and Methods of Lie Detection
Eitan Elaad

This book presents updated information on deception and the methods developed to uncover lies. The author describes a wide range of lies, the verbal and nonverbal cues to deception and the perceived cues, which often mislead lie-catchers. Other issues considered are: Do animals lie? At what age do children begin to lie? Do frequent lies indicate some personality disorder or are they a fact of social life? The most prominent method used to detect deception is the polygraph.This volume provides basic information about the polygraph, revealing misconceptions and myths tied to its operation. Other methods constructed to detect lies, such as honesty tests, content analysis and linguistic methods, are also surveyed.
